Course Summary
Our vision for MFL at HHS is to provide students with ‘a liberation from insularity’ and ‘an opening to other cultures’. We want to equip pupils with the knowledge and cultural capital they need to succeed in life and to encourage pupils to appreciate and celebrate difference. We want our students to see that the world is a much bigger place than the rural environment that they currently live in and that learning a foreign language is an important part of integrating into this wider world. We also aim to try to give students the opportunity to visit a country of the language of study so that they are given opportunities to practise in real life contexts.
Course Details
We follow the EDUQAS exam board for A-level languages. Four different themes are covered over the course of the two years of study:
A LEVEL FRENCH:
Being a young person in French-speaking society (Families and citizenship, Youth trends and personal identity, education and employment opportunities)
Understanding the French-speaking world (Regional culture and heritage in France, French-speaking countries and communities, Media, art, film and music in the French-speaking world)
Diversity and difference (Migration and integration, Cultural identity and marginalisation, Cultural enrichment and celebrating difference, Discrimination and diversity)
France 1940-1950: The Occupation and post-war years (June 1940–May 1945, The cultural dimension in occupied France, 1945-1950)
The A level consists of 3 components which make up the final grade awarded;
Component 1 – Speaking 30% of qualification – A presentation of an independent research project followed by a theme based discussion on another topic.
Component 2 – Listening, Reading & Translation 50% of qualification
Component 3 – Critical and analytical response in writing 20% of qualification. This consists of writing 2 essays; one based on a literary work studied and the other on another literary work or a film studied.
